Veterinarian in San Francisco and San Carlos, California | Veterinary Vision Animal Eye Specialists

Description: Veterinary Vision Animal Eye Specialists is dedicated to providing high-quality veterinary care for the San Francisco and San Carlos, California communities.

Health Animal Veterinary Medicine Veterinarians United States California 网站

2024年11月14日

返回